Online Success Comes Down to Traffic

Blogs, websites, books, products, services, and everything else online all have one thing in common, and that is the need for traffic.  In fact, to be successful at anything online all comes down to traffic.


With the launch of my new blog and plan to focus entirely on branding myself this year, I thought it fitting to choose the topic that is always on everyone’s minds.  Traffic is what ultimately translates into book sales, product sales, and repeat customers for any online services.  In the past, this has been a huge challenge for me to tackle as an aspiring writer and later, a published author.   But even when I recognized just how much a problem the lack of traffic, viewers, and readership could be; doing what it takes to solve the problem wasn’t easy.

Addressing a Major Challenge

A major challenge to online writing, marketing, and conducting internet business, is acquiring traffic. No matter what your internet goals happen to be, you will never reach them without jumping this particular hurdle; not just once, but on a regular basis.

If you write articles – YOU NEED traffic for page views, if you do affiliate marketing, YOU NEED traffic for sales leads, if you publish ebooks, YOU NEED traffic for reviews and ebook sales. There is no getting around the fact that when you work and promote online, YOU NEED TRAFFIC!

Traffic will always be a major challenge for online writers, marketers and internet business ventures. Page views, readership, visitors, no matter what you call it, it all amounts to actually connecting people to what you have to offer. That translates into traffic.

Because generating traffic is a lot harder than people imagine, this can become a number one obstacle to your success. Your degree of traffic (or lack thereof) will eventually determine whether you continue your online endeavors or give up entirely. That brings us to the all-important point of sticking to it.
